Key Player Performances

When analyzing a Cavaliers vs. Celtics game, pinpointing key player performances is crucial to understanding the game's dynamics. Let's start with the Cavaliers. One player who consistently stands out is Donovan Mitchell. Known for his explosive scoring ability and clutch performances, Mitchell's stats are often a bellwether for the team’s success. Today, we saw Mitchell driving hard to the basket, creating opportunities for his teammates, and knocking down critical shots. His final stat line included 32 points, 6 assists, and 5 rebounds. While those numbers are impressive, his efficiency from the field could have been better, shooting 45% overall but only 33% from beyond the arc. His defensive presence was also notable, recording two steals and a block, indicating his commitment on both ends of the court. Another Cavalier to watch is Jarrett Allen. His presence in the paint is essential for the team’s rebounding and defensive efforts. Today, Allen contributed a double-double with 14 points and 12 rebounds, showcasing his value as a reliable inside presence. His ability to alter shots and protect the rim cannot be understated, making him a vital component of the Cavaliers' defensive strategy.

On the Celtics side, Jayson Tatum is always a focal point. Tatum’s versatility and scoring prowess make him a constant threat. In today’s game, Tatum delivered a balanced performance, scoring 28 points, grabbing 8 rebounds, and dishing out 7 assists. His ability to score from anywhere on the court keeps defenses on their toes, and his playmaking skills are continually improving. Tatum's leadership was evident as he orchestrated the offense and made smart decisions in crucial moments. Jaylen Brown is another Celtic whose performance is pivotal. Brown’s athleticism and scoring ability complement Tatum perfectly, forming a dynamic duo that opponents struggle to contain. Today, Brown scored 25 points with a high shooting percentage, demonstrating his efficiency and impact on the game. His aggressive drives to the basket and ability to finish strong make him a constant threat in transition. Additionally, his defensive contributions, including a steal and a block, highlighted his commitment on both ends of the floor.

Scoring Breakdown

Let's break down the Cavaliers vs. Celtics game, focusing on the scoring aspects. The Cavaliers' offensive strategy heavily relies on their star players, particularly Donovan Mitchell, to create scoring opportunities. Mitchell’s ability to penetrate the defense and either finish at the rim or kick the ball out to open shooters is crucial for their offensive flow. Today, Mitchell scored 32 points, leading the team in scoring. His aggressive drives forced the Celtics' defense to collapse, opening up opportunities for teammates like Caris LeVert and Darius Garland. LeVert contributed 18 points, showcasing his ability to score from various spots on the floor. Garland, while not having his best scoring night with 15 points, played a vital role in facilitating the offense and distributing the ball. The Cavaliers' supporting cast also played a significant role in the scoring breakdown. Players like Jarrett Allen and Evan Mobley provided valuable points in the paint, capitalizing on offensive rebounds and second-chance opportunities. Allen’s 14 points and Mobley’s 10 points demonstrated their importance in the Cavaliers' offensive scheme.

On the Celtics side, the scoring load is primarily carried by Jayson Tatum and Jaylen Brown. Tatum, with 28 points, and Brown, with 25 points, consistently lead the team in scoring. Their ability to create their own shots and score in isolation situations makes them difficult to guard. Tatum’s versatility allows him to score from anywhere on the court, whether it’s driving to the basket, pulling up for a mid-range jumper, or knocking down three-pointers. Brown’s athleticism and aggressive drives to the rim make him a constant threat in transition and half-court sets. The Celtics also benefit from the contributions of their role players. Derrick White added 16 points, providing a spark off the bench with his scoring and playmaking abilities. Kristaps Porziņģis contributed 14 points, utilizing his size and shooting ability to stretch the floor and create mismatches. The Celtics' offensive depth allows them to maintain a high level of scoring even when their star players are facing tough defensive matchups.
